Output 3a759103270326660ffea5ca3e16f1004e7712ea49d6e8bc3a645601d2bc8d9b:0

value
1081292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93214a50112c544338e83ec258060eecd2328cdc OP_EQUAL
address
3F6y8nudb3HuM7Bz5MKVXty22CKuMiTkYH
transaction
3a759103270326660ffea5ca3e16f1004e7712ea49d6e8bc3a645601d2bc8d9b
spent
true